Polymyalgia rheumatica (PMR)is a common cause of stiffness and aching across the body that occurs in people older than 50. Stiffness and aching because of PMR are most common in the: 1. upper arms 2. lower back 3. thighs 4. neck Stiffness and pain may be worse in the morning. WebAug 22, 2024 · If you have chronic muscle stiffness, heat in the form of a toasty bath, warm compress, or heated blanket may bring you some relief. This is because it: Relaxes the muscles Improves blood flow May reduce spasms and stiffness It’s important to note that heat should not be used on inflamed or swollen injuries, as it can aggravate them.
